Albenga Baptistery
Museum
Photo: Erik den yngre, CC BY-SA 4.0.
The Baptistery of Albenga is a paleochristian religious structure in Albenga, province of Savona, in the region of Liguria of northern Italy. It is an example of 5th-century late-Ancient Roman architecture with mosaic decoration, and stands adjacent to the Albenga Cathedral of San Michele Arcangelo. Albenga Baptistery is situated 3 km south of San Giorgio.
Albenga Cathedral
Church
Photo: Mediatus, CC BY-SA 3.0.
Albenga Cathedral is a Roman Catholic cathedral dedicated to Saint Michael in the city of Albenga, in the province of Savona and the region of Liguria, Italy. Albenga Cathedral is situated 3 km south of San Giorgio.
